Sea temperature
In Grand-Bourg, the average seawater temperature in August is 29°C (84.2°F).
Note: For activities such as swimming and diving, temperatures between 25°C (77°F) and 29°C (84.2°F) are perceived as particularly pleasant and satisfying for prolonged periods without feeling uneasy.
Daylight
In Grand-Bourg, the average length of the day in August is 12h and 38min.
On the first day of August, sunrise is at 05:46 and sunset at 18:36. On the last day of the month, sunrise is at 05:52 and sunset at 18:18 AST.
